How to Cancel Bank of America
Bank of America is the second-largest bank in the US, offering checking, savings, credit cards, and investment accounts. Account closure can be done in-branch, by phone, or by mail. Ensure all transactions are settled and recurring payments moved before closing.

Cancellation Steps
Go directly to Bank of America cancellation pageTransfer your funds
Move your balance to a new bank. Update direct deposits and autopayments.
Let pending transactions clear
Wait for all pending debits, checks, and recurring charges to process.
Close the account
Visit a branch with photo ID, call 1-800-432-1000, or send a written request.
Confirm zero balance
Ensure the account shows a zero balance before requesting closure.
Get written confirmation
Request a closure confirmation letter for your records.
Tips & Things to Know
- Bank of America may charge an early closure fee if the account is less than 90 days old.
- Redeem all credit card rewards before closing a BofA card.
- If you have a Merrill Edge investment account, it must be closed separately.

Frequently Asked Questions
- Can I close my BofA account online?
- No. You must visit a branch, call, or send a written request.
- Is there an early closure fee?
- Yes. A $25 fee may apply if you close within 90 days of opening.
- What happens to my debit card?
- Your debit card is deactivated immediately upon account closure.
- How do I close a BofA credit card?
- Call 1-800-732-9194 to close credit card accounts.
- Can I close a joint account alone?
- Both account holders typically need to consent to closing a joint account.
